Last analyzed September 17, 2026. > UpRock AI is an insight engine that provides structured, agent-ready data from the live web. It fetches multi-engine, multi-modal, and multi-geo data from real mobile devices across 190+ countries via a single API and MCP endpoint, enabling AI agents to run broader, fetch deeper, and ship with local accuracy at scale.
